Abstract
The design of automatic cat feeding device using android and SMS gateway arduino based will feed the cat contained in containers1 and 2. At lunch hour the container 1 will open up to 50g of feed weight to fill the cat's feeding place and will provide information in the form of SMS that the cat has been fed. While in the afternoon hours then the container 2 will open up to the weight of feed on the 50g cat cats and will provide information in the form of SMS messages containing cats have been fed. For curfew container 1 and 2 will be up to 100g of cat weight for each container and will provide information in the form of SMS that the cat has been fed dinner. This tool also provides information in the form of SMS when the container 1 or 2 will run out. The coverage of the SMS operator depends on the signal from the operator used by the SIM900A modem, as long as the signal is still available or within the range of the monitoring tower, the SMS information service will continue to function.
